Authentic Parisian Market Immersion
Dive into the lively atmosphere of Marché d’Aligre, a historic open-air and covered market in the 12th arrondissement. Experience the daily life of Parisians as you interact with local vendors and discover the freshest seasonal ingredients.

Meeting Point:
Marché d’Aligre Entrance
Meet your chef guide at the entrance to Marché d’Aligre, located in the vibrant 12th arrondissement, a neighborhood known for its authentic Parisian charm and culinary diversity.
Stop 1:
Introduction to Marché d’Aligre
(30 minutes)
Begin with an overview of the market’s history and significance in Parisian life. Stroll through the open-air section, tasting seasonal fruits and vegetables while learning how to spot the best quality produce.
Stop 2:
Covered Market Exploration
(40 minutes)
Enter the historic covered market to sample artisanal cheeses, cured meats, and other regional specialties. Engage with passionate vendors and discover the stories behind their products.
Stop 3:
Fresh Bread & Pastry Tasting
(30 minutes)
Visit a nearby boulangerie to taste freshly baked baguettes and pastries. Learn what defines exceptional French bread and the role it plays in daily meals from your expert chef.
Stop 4:
Local Specialty Shops
(40 minutes)
Explore hidden artisanal shops around the market, tasting unique products like homemade jams, honeys, or charcuterie. Understand the craftsmanship behind these delicacies with insider commentary.
Stop 5:
Final Tasting & Market Recap
(40 minutes)
Conclude with a relaxed tasting session at a local spot, enjoying a curated selection of market finds paired with a refreshing beverage. Reflect on your discoveries and receive personalized recipe ideas.
